Valve Clearances

I have an 84' Jetta 1.7L. I checked the valve clearances and got the following results:

Cyl. Intake Exhaust

1 .006 .017 2 .006 .013 3 .007 .014 4 .006 .015

They are all out of spec.(according to haynes(intake:.008-.012 exh:.016-.020)) and the clearances are all to small.

The engine was at operating temp. when they were checked.(The rad. fan came on and I tried to work PDQ)

I think it would be better if the clearances were cold spec. as you wouldn't burn your fingers.

Haynes lists these clearances for ALL engines covered by manual. Does Bentley have anything different?
